Role Overview
As a Manager Data Center, you will lead a team in building and supporting supercomputers and HPC-AI clusters within NVIDIA's networking clusters solutions group.
What You’ll Be Doing
- Lead and coordinate the planning and build of complex clusters across multiple data centers and labs.
- Manage rack-and-stack, cabling, and space optimization efforts for efficiency.
- Oversee power and cooling strategies while ensuring optimal rack utilization.
- Coordinate daily operations and maintenance of data facilities and test environments.
- Install and integrate diverse infrastructures including Cloud, VMs, Storage, Network, HPC, and AI.
- Manage debugging activities involving network, optical cabling, bare metal, and operating systems.
- Collaborate closely with R&D teams to support project needs and experimental setups.
- Mentor and develop team members, fostering knowledge sharing and professional growth.
What We Need To See
- MCSE or MCITP / CCNA certification.
- 3+ years of experience as a team lead in large and complex data center environments; 8+ years overall.
- Strong practical experience with operating systems and troubleshooting.
- In-depth knowledge of Linux & Windows Core Services (DHCP, DNS, NIS, AD, etc.).
- Strong leadership skills with the ability to organize, prioritize, and guide a team.
- Passionate about delivering excellent service with strong collaboration and interpersonal skills.
Ways To Stand Out
- Hands-on experience with Python and configuration management tools like Ansible and Puppet.
- Experience with CI tools and job schedulers such as Jenkins and SLURM.
- Knowledge of virtualization technologies like KVM, VMware, and Hyper-V.
- Experience with storage solutions such as Netapp, Lustre, GPFS, ZFS.
- Strong understanding of L2 & L3 network protocols and technical issue resolution.
